The Department of Theatre and Dance at Texas State University presents John Guare’s The House of Blue Leaves Nov. 18-23. Performances will be Nov. 18-22 at 7:30 p.m. with a 2 p.m. matinee performance on Nov. 23 in the University Performing Arts Center.
The House of Blue Leaves is an outrageous comedy about Artie, a zoo keeper who dreams of becoming a famous songwriter. In this ode to the American Dream, Artie’s quest for fame and fortune is thwarted by his crazy wife, an overbearing girlfriend, and a menagerie of other characters. The production is directed by Jay Jennings.
